1 Male 2 Female Trios

Hey musicla theater buffs!

Does anyone know of some good trios for one guy and two girls?

I have these in mind: The I Love You Song, Not Getting Married Today, antything ftom Starting Here Starting Now

However, I'm still looking and would apreciate your help!
#3

re: 1 Male 2 Female Trios

I'm Only Thinking of Him from Man of LaMancha
A Step Too Far from Aida
Two Ladies from Cabaret (naturally)
Buddy's Blues from Follies can be done with two women and a man
Yellow Drum from Grass Harp
A Heart Full of Love from Les Mis
The second Not a Day Goes By from Merrily
I think it's the last letter from Passion involves all three main characters.
Happy to Make Your Acquaintance from Most Happy Fella
